td {
	
}
a {
	text-decoration: underline;
	color:#174964;
}

body { background-color: #1d2d41; background-image: url(../images/template/en/left_px.jpg); background-repeat: repeat-x; background-position: 0 top; margin:0; padding:0; 
text-align: left;
	vertical-align: top;
	font-family:Arial;
	font-size:12px;
	color:#174964;
	line-height:18px;

}
.copy{
font-family:Arial;
font-size:10px;
color:#FFFFFF;
text-decoration:none;
}

.blue {color:#174964}
.red {color:#742C15; font-size:11px}
.white {color:#FFFFFF}
.small {font-size:11px}
.gray {color:#6E6D6C; 
font-family:tahoma; 
font-size:11px}


a:hover{text-decoration:underline;}

#under{text-decoration:underline;}
/*  begin styles */

#wrap { background-image: url(../images/template/en/left.jpg); background-repeat: repeat-x; background-position: 0 top; width: 778px; height: 900px; margin: 0 auto; padding: 0; }

#center { vertical-align: top; width: 727px; margin: 0 auto; padding: 0; }

#top_spacer { background-color: #dfe5e8; width: 727px; height: 30px; float: left; margin: 57px 0 0; padding: 0;}

#top_menu { color: silver; font-family: Arial; background-image: url(../images/template/en/top.jpg); background-repeat: repeat-y; vertical-align: bottom; width: 727px; height: 79px; float: left; margin: 0; padding: 0; }

#top_spacer1 { background-image: url(../images/template/en/top1.jpg); background-repeat: no-repeat; width: 727px; height: 32px; float: left; margin: 0; padding: 0; }

#menu { color: white; font-size: 15px; font-family: Arial; background-image: url(../images/template/en/menu.jpg); background-repeat: no-repeat; background-position: 0 top; text-align: right; width: 203px; height: 256px; float: left; margin: 0; padding: 0; }
#menu a { color: white; font-size: 15px; font-weight: bold; line-height: 19px; text-decoration: none; }
#menu a:hover { color: white; text-decoration: underline; }

#menu td { color: white; font-size: 14px; font-family: Arial; text-align: left; vertical-align: bottom; }

#menu_arr { background-image: url(../images/template/en/top_arrow.jpg); background-repeat: no-repeat; width: 4px; height: 9px; float: left; margin: 7px 8px; }

#header { background-image: url(../images/template/en/top_im.jpg); background-repeat: no-repeat; background-position: 0 top; width: 524px; height: 256px; float: right; margin: 0; padding: 0; }

#header1 { background-image: url(../images/template/en/top_im1.jpg); background-repeat: no-repeat; background-position: 0 top; width: 524px; height: 256px; float: right; margin: 0; padding: 0; }

#header2 { background-image: url(../images/template/en/top_im2.jpg); background-repeat: no-repeat; background-position: 0 top; width: 524px; height: 256px; float: right; margin: 0; padding: 0; }

#header3 { background-image: url(../images/template/en/top_im3.jpg); background-repeat: no-repeat; background-position: 0 top; width: 524px; height: 256px; float: right; margin: 0; padding: 0; }

#header4 { background-image: url(../images/template/en/top_im4.jpg); background-repeat: no-repeat; background-position: 0 top; width: 524px; height: 256px; float: right; margin: 0; padding: 0; }

#cont_main { background-image: url(../images/template/en/px.jpg); background-repeat: repeat-y; width: 727px; float: left; margin: 0; padding: 0; }

#spacer_h_c { background-image: url(../images/template/en/px1.jpg); background-repeat: repeat-x; width: 525px; height: 3px; float: right; margin: 0; padding: 0; }

#featured_left_vert { width: 202px; float: left; margin: 0; padding: 0; }

#featured { background-color: #dbe5ec; width: 187px; float: left; margin-top: 7px; margin-left: 5px; border: solid 1px white; }

#search_res { background-color: #dbe5ec; width: 187px; float: left; margin-top: 7px; margin-right: 20px; margin-left: 20px; border: solid 2px white; }

#featured_img img { text-decoration: none; border: solid 1px white; }

#content { width: 525px; float: right; margin: 0; padding: 0; }

#content_about { background-image: url(../images/template/en/bckgr_about.jpg); background-repeat: no-repeat; width: 523px; float: right; margin: 0; padding: 0; }

#content_legal { background-image: url(../images/template/en/bckgr_legal.jpg); background-repeat: no-repeat; width: 523px; float: right; margin: 0; padding: 0; }

#content1 { width: 510px; float: right; margin: 0; padding: 0 0 0 10px; }

#text_main { width: 470px; float: left; margin-top: 22px; margin-left: 15px;
text-align: left;
	vertical-align: top;
	font-family:Arial;
	font-size:12px;
	color:#174964;
	line-height:18px; }
	
#latest { width: 330px; float: left; margin-top: 20px; padding-left: 14px; }

#pics { width: 170px; height: 167px; float: left; margin: 15px 0 10px; }

#footer { background-image: url(../images/template/en/bottom.jpg); background-repeat: no-repeat; background-position: 0 top; width: 727px; height: 82px; float: left; margin: 0; padding: 0; }

#footer_cont { text-align: center; vertical-align: top; width: 727px; float: left; margin: 20px 0 0; }

/* UMP */

.flags {
	float:right;
	margin-top:0px;
}

.flags a img {border:none; padding-right:5px;}

img { border:none;}

/* LISTING BROWSE PAGE NAVIGATION WIDGET 'next_prev()'display stuff  */

.browse_tool_table { width:100%; font-size: 11px; text-decoration: none; color: black; background-color: transparent; margin-top: 6px; }
.browse_tool {
	background-color: silver;
	font-size: 11px;
	text-decoration: none;
	color: black;
}
.browse_tool_num {
	color: #336699;
}

.browse_tool_button A { background-color: silver; font-size: 10px; line-height: 10px; text-align: center; font-weight: bold; text-decoration: none; color: #000000; width: 82px; height: 18px; display: block; padding: 3px; border: outset 1px; }

.browse_tool_button A:visited {
	color: #000000;
}

.browse_tool_button A:hover {
	color: navy;
	BORDER-STYLE: inset;
	width: 82px;
	height: 18px;
}

.browse_tool_ghost {
	font-size: 10px;
	line-height: 10px;
	color: #aaaaaa;
	text-decoration: none;
}


.browse_tool_curpage {
	BACKGROUND-COLOR: #f8f8f8;
	color: #CCCCCC;
	width: 24px;
	height: 20px;
	display: block;
	text-align: center;
}

.bt_pages {
	font-family: verdana, arial, Helvetica, sans-serif;
	BACKGROUND-COLOR: #D1DEE9;
	text-decoration:none;
	font-size: 10px;
	vertical-align: middle;
	color:	#000000;
	padding: 5px;
}

bt_pages_ghost{
	color:	#aaaaaa;
	text-decoration:none;
}

A.bt_pages{
	color:	#000000;
	width: 24px;
	height: 20px;
	display: block;
	text-align: center;
}

A.bt_pages:visited{
	color: #000000;
}

A.bt_pages:hover{
	color:#FFFFFF;
	background: #132975;
}
/* LISTING PAGE DETAILS 'listing_next_prev'  */
.next_prev_listing { margin: 2em 0 2em 3em;  border: 1px solid #a9a9a9; width: 40em; text-align: center; }
.next_prev_listing ul { margin: 1.5em auto; }
.next_prev_listing li { display: inline; padding: .5em 1em; list-style-type: none; }
.count, .listing_xy { width: 100%; background-color: #dcdcdc; clear: both; padding: .5em 0; }
